How Much of the Worsening Energy Crisis is Due to Depletion?

Coal and natural gas spot prices have recently soared to record levels internationally, while oil is trading at over $80 a barrel—the highest price in seven years. Newspaper columnists are asking whether people in Europe and Asia who can’t afford high fuel and electricity prices might freeze this winter. High natural gas prices are causing … Continue reading How Much of the Worsening Energy Crisis is Due to Depletion?